  • Applications

    (-)-Sandaracopimaric acid, CAS 471-74-9, is primarily used as a chemical building block for diterpene synthesis and is evaluated as a resinous component or fixative in fragrance formulations; it can be esterified to form rosin-based derivatives that act as tackifiers in coatings, inks, and adhesives; in polymer and plastics applications it serves as a functional starting material for specialty diterpenoid additives; in cosmetics and personal care it may be used as a fragrance ingredient or resin-like modifier; in industrial manufacturing it is commonly pursued as an intermediate for the synthesis of other terpenoid compounds.
